Highway Infrastructure Limited announced it has received a Letter of Acceptance (LOA) from Atal Indore City Transport Services Limited for an EPC service contract valued at ₹1.09 crore. The contract involves the supply, installation, testing, and commissioning of external electrification infrastructure for e-bus charging facilities at the Dewas Naka Depot in Niranjanpur. Mahindra Logistics Expands Eastern Footprint with New Warehousing Facilities
Mahindra Logistics Limited has launched two warehousing facilities in Eastern India, adding over 400,000 square feet of capacity to its regional network. The facilities, located in Guwahati and Agartala, form part of the company’s strategic expansion in the eastern region. Hyundai Mobis Partners 23 Companies to Develop Korean Automotive Chip Ecosystem
Automotive components and technology developer Hyundai Mobis, which is a key member of the Hyundai Motor Group, recently hosted the first ‘Auto Semicon Korea’ (ASK) conclave in Seoul. The event is part of the company’s effort to strengthen automotive semiconductor competitiveness and expand the ecosystem in Korea.
